Abstract

A cryptographic primitive suggested by Carnard et al. in 2012 ensures that on input a plaintext, ciphertext with corresponding public key, it is possible to check if a ciphertext is encryption of a target plaintext with a corresponding public key. This tool enables public plaintext query on ciphertext. We introduce ID-based plaintext checkable encryption (ID-PCE) in outsourced healthcare database. ID-PCE uses receiver's ID as the public key to curtail problems associated with key certificate management in public key encryption. We adopts identity-based cryptography and it achieves a weak-IND-ID-CCA (W-IND-IDCCA). Finally, proof the security of our scheme using random oracle model.
